Elements of Communication 1. Sender Source of the message/information 2. Message information, ideas, or thoughts conveyed by the speaker in words or in actions.

Elements of Communication 3. Encoding process of converting the message into words, actions, or other forms that the speaker understands. 4 . Channel medium or the means wherein the encoded message is conveyed.

Elements of Communication 5. Decoding process of interpreting the encoded message of the speaker by the receiver. 6. Receiver someone who decodes the message.

Elements of Communication 7. Feedback reactions, responses, or information provided by the receiver. 8 . Context environment where communication takes place.

Elements of Communication 9. Barrier The noise in communication. Factors that affect the flow of communication.
